Global4PL Named as Recipient of "2010 Green Supply Chain Awards" for the Fourth Consecutive Year by Supply & Demand Chain Executive Magazine
  

SANTA CLARA, CA -(Marketwire - November 10, 2010) - Global4PL, a leading supply chain solutions provider that specializes in helping companies optimize operations and reduce operation costs, announced it was selected as a recipient of the 2010 Green Supply Chain Awards, by Supply & Demand Chain Executive Magazine, for the fourth consecutive year. The award recognizes companies that are making sustainability a core part of their supply chain strategies.
 
"Leading companies are recognizing sustainability as a potential competitive advantage in a time of supply constraints and demand volatility," said Andrew K. Reese, editor, Supply & Demand Chain Executive. "The 2010 Green Supply Chain Awards highlight the role of the supply chain as a key enabler of sustainability." Global4PL's recognition continues a string of achievements that includes over 17 awards over the last five years.
